HOW TO BLOG FOR EXTRA INCOME
Over the last few years, countless people have entered the world of blogging as a way of earning extra income. It is not surprising therefore that resource on how to blog abound both online and in physical media like books and magazines.
To start a blog is actually very easy. For starters, as you learn how to blog, you don’t even need to spend a single cent. Free blogging platforms like Blogger, WordPress, Tumblr, Opera, and others can provide you with the means to setup your blog. From there you can learn how to post articles, manage comments, experiment with layouts, and monetize your blog.
As you become more confident with blogging, you can then go for a hosted blog that will have a top-level dot com address that you yourself choose.
Below is a short description of the steps you’ll need as you learn how to blog.
First, you need a core focus topic, or a niche. Your blog’s contents should stay within the niche to maintain the interest of your target audience. You can choose a niche that is close to your heart, something that you are passionate about. Your passion and familiarity with the niche will make you an expert and your blog’s contents will help to develop your reputation and credibility within your audience.
Second, you will need a title that can catch readersí attention. You will also need a relevant domain name for hosted blogs, or a subdomain name if using Blogger.
Third, you can start posting entries into your blog on a regular basis. Your blog entries should contain information useful to your audience. You can also allow the audience to comment on your posts to encourage discussion of the topic you posted. It is also possible to allow readers to share your posts via email or social media platforms like Twitter and Facebook.
Fourth, you can experiment with different blog layouts to make your blog more appealing to your audience. The different blogging platforms allow add columns, spaces for photos and videos, subscription forms, surveys, and others.
Fifth, after you have written enough articles or blog entries, you can start to monetize your blog. You can apply for a Adsense account and let Google post advertisements on your blog that are related to whatever blog post is on display. This is called contextual advertising. There are other advertising platforms also, if Google doesn’t accept your application. You can also apply to be an affiliate of the various affiliate networks and marketplaces. Examples of these are Clickbank, Amazon, Commission Junction, and Linkshare. By promoting links or banners that represent a product on these marketplaces, you can earn income from the purchases your audience makes via your affiliate links. You will need to embed these links on strategic areas of your blog, even in the text of your posts.
Lastly, you will need to promote your blog. You can include your blog’s URL in your email signature and in your Facebook profile. You can also visit related blogs and post constructive comments on posts, followed by a signature that includes your blog’s name and URL.
As you can see, it is not that difficult to learn how to blog. Start slow and without any expenses, develop your confidence in writing and reaching out to your audience, and slowly realize your potential to blog for extra income.
